Mark unallocated/freed memory as inaccessible using ASan functionality
Note: to disable it, AO_NO_MALLOC_POISON should be defined by client.
* src/atomic_ops_malloc.c [AO_ADDRESS_SANITIZER && !AO_NO_MALLOC_POISON]
(__asan_poison_memory_region, __asan_unpoison_memory_region): Prototype.
* src/atomic_ops_malloc.c (ASAN_POISON_MEMORY_REGION,
ASAN_UNPOISON_MEMORY_REGION): New macro.
* src/atomic_ops_malloc.c (add_chunk_as): Call
ASAN_POISON_MEMORY_REGION() for each pushed region.
* src/atomic_ops_malloc.c (AO_malloc): Call
ASAN_UNPOISON_MEMORY_REGION() for the returned memory region.
* src/atomic_ops_malloc.c (AO_free): Call ASAN_POISON_MEMORY_REGION()
before pushing the freed region to AO_free_list.
